Uruguay's culture: the influence of its past
Several major events in the history of Uruguay
have had a very important influence in this country's culture and
the identity of its population. Uruguay culture was built through
centuries of historical facts and events such as being invaded by
foreign forces and fighting for the land back, receiving important
amounts of European immigrants, going through a very severe dictatorship,
recovering the democracy state, and suffering very a hard economical
crisis, among others, have had a major role in molding the country's
culture and the personality of its people.
Uruguay's culture: traditions
Uruguayans are united by several traditions
which are one of the main factors giving shape to the country's culture.
Among these traditions we can name, for example, drinking "mate".
The "mate", a beverage typical of the region, is a way through
which Uruguayans socialize, and through it they could even recognize
another fellow-citizen at any other spot in the world. Some other
traditional elements of Uruguay are its music, the typical meals,
and the "rambla" walks, among many more.

Some seasons are very important in relation
with Uruguay's traditions, like for example summer time. During some
summer time weeks, Uruguay goes through "carnaval", and
one of the most important events during these époque is the
appearance of the "murgas" and their shows at the "tablados".
The "murgas" are specifically Uruguayan and consist on a
group of people who sang self made letters regarding the society,
news, the government, and any important matter regarding actuality
in a rather ironic and entertaining way.
